Technical Specifications

Parameter NameValue
TypeParameter
Lifecycle Status IN PRODUCTION (Last Updated: 1 month ago)
Factory Lead Time 10 Weeks
Mount Surface Mount
Mounting Type Surface Mount, MLCC
Package / Case 0201 (0603 Metric)
Terminal Shape WRAPAROUND
Dielectric MaterialCERAMIC
Operating Temperature-55°C~105°C
PackagingTape & Reel (TR)
Series GRM
Size / Dimension 0.024Lx0.012W 0.60mmx0.30mm
Tolerance ±10%
JESD-609 Code e3
Pbfree Code yes
Part StatusActive
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 2
ECCN Code EAR99
Temperature CoefficientX6S
Terminal Finish Matte Tin (Sn) - with Nickel (Ni) barrier
Applications General Purpose
Capacitance 0.1μF
Voltage - Rated DC 6.3V
Packing Method TR, PAPER, 7 INCH
Case Code (Metric) 0603
Case Code (Imperial) 0201
Capacitor Type CERAMIC CAPACITOR
Temperature Characteristics Code X6S
Multilayer Yes
Height 0.3mm
Length 0.6mm
Width 0.3mm
Thickness (Max) 0.013 0.33mm
Thickness 330.2μm
RoHS StatusROHS3 Compliant
Lead Free Lead Free
